Job description

Description

This job is responsible for engaging clients in the lobby to educate and assist with conducting transactions through self-service resources, such as mobile banking, online banking, or ATM. Key responsibilities include accurately and efficiently processing cash transactions for clients as needed. Job expectations include having deep conversations with clients to gain in-depth knowledge of their financial and life priorities and connecting clients to solutions that meet their financial goals.

Responsibilities :

  1. Executes the bank's risk culture and strives for operational excellence.
  2. Builds relationships with clients to meet their financial needs.
  3. Follows established processes and guidelines in daily activities to do what is right for clients and the bank, adhering to all applicable laws and regulations.
  4. Grows business knowledge and network by partnering with experts in small business, lending, and investments.
  5. Manages financial center traffic, appointments, and outbound calls effectively.
  6. Drives the client experience.
  7. Manages cash responsibilities.

Required Qualifications :

  • Is an enthusiastic, highly motivated self-starter with a strong work ethic and an intense focus on results, acting in the best interest of the client.
  • Collaborates effectively to get things done, building and nurturing strong relationships.
  • Displays passion, commitment, and drive to deliver an experience that improves our clients' financial lives.
  • Is confident in identifying solutions for new and existing clients based on their needs.
  • Communicates effectively and confidently and is comfortable engaging all clients.
  • Has the ability to learn and adapt to new information and technology platforms.
  • Is confident in educating clients on how to conduct simple banking transactions through self-service technologies (for example, ATM, online banking, mobile banking).
  • Applies strong critical thinking and problem-solving skills to meet clients' needs.
  • Follows established processes and guidelines in daily activities to do what is right for clients and the bank, adhering to all applicable laws and regulations.
  • Efficiently manages time and capacity.
  • Focuses on results, while acting in the best interest of the client.
  • Can be flexible to work weekends and/or extended hours as needed.

Desired Qualifications :

  • Experience in financial services and knowledge of financial services industry, products, and solutions.
  • One year of demonstrated successful sales experience in a salary plus incentive environment with individual sales goals.
  • Six months of cash handling experience.
  • Bachelor's degree or a business-relevant associate degree such as business management, business administration, or finance.
